| The training of communication talents is an indispensable part of the communication industry.With the rapid development of information technology and communication system,the increasing of types of communication equipment and the complexity of network function have brought great challenges to the management of communication equipment.So how to use the limited resources to maximize the effective rate of personnel training has gradually become one of the research goal of many researchers.With the gradual development of computer simulation technology and computer technology,simulation platform based on software is greatly effective in this aspect so that simulation platform or simulation laboratory in various fields appeared constantly,but the development of the simulation platform of communication equipment using computer simulation technology is still urgent.Based on the development of dedicated communication equipment simulation platform,this paper has a full investigation of the existing possible demand scenarios in communication equipment simulation platforn and achievements of some researchers,and then make full use of UML modeling technology and case demand driven to make a design of communication equipment general simulation platform architecture.Out of general consideration,this architecture is the abstract design of communication equipment simulation platform,simulation platform in the actual development still need the demand analysis of user-defined functions and extensive functions according to the specific needs of specific equipment.And in the progress of general architecture design,this paper built the information model for communication equipment simulation core resources which may appear in the platform.These resources could be divided into physical resources and logic resources.Physical equipment appeared in the equipment room is associated with the core physical resources which is entity-representation of physical equipment in communication equipment simulation platform.Then,this paper analyzed and designed the relationship between resources according to the entity relations that may appear in physical devices,such as inclusion and association relations,and gave birth to the relation diagrams between information models.In the same time,this paper designed abstract information model that represent the logical resources in the simulation platform,the detailed design such as related properties and interface of all of the above information model,based on the hierarchical network theory and combined with the simulation platform the key technology needs.The design of universal,extensible,reusable design idea not only reflected in the design of architecture and information model,but also reflected in the design of the key technology.This paper gives the design of data service,universal service test connectivity testing and visualization layer modular design.These key technologies of information model of core resources based on the previous,make full use of the information model and the correlation among them,provide critical suggestions and reference for communication equipment simulation platform development.Finally,this paper developed the simulation platform of PTN communication equipment based on B/S architecture and SSM framework,and make use of the key technology process design to achieve the key function,and then to verified the design rationality of platform architecture,information model and the key technology.Results show that the design for the development of practical communication equipment simulation platform can be strongly supportive. |
